ToolStripTextBox.GetLineFromCharIndex(Int32) ToolStripTextBox.GetLineFromCharIndex(Int32) ToolStripTextBox.GetLineFromCharIndex(Int32) ToolStripTextBox.GetLineFromCharIndex(Int32) Method

Definición

Recupera el número de línea desde la posición de carácter especificada dentro del texto del control.Retrieves the line number from the specified character position within the text of the control.

public:
 int GetLineFromCharIndex(int index);
public int GetLineFromCharIndex (int index);
member this.GetLineFromCharIndex : int -> int
Public Function GetLineFromCharIndex (index As Integer) As Integer

Parámetros

index
Int32 Int32 Int32 Int32

Posición del índice de carácter que se va a buscar.The character index position to search.

Devoluciones

Número de línea de base cero donde se encuentra el índice de carácter.The zero-based line number in which the character index is located.

Comentarios

Este método permite determinar el número de línea basándose en el índice de caracteres especificado en index el parámetro del método.This method enables you to determine the line number based on the character index specified in the index parameter of the method. La primera línea de texto del control devuelve el valor cero.The first line of text in the control returns the value zero. El GetLineFromCharIndex método devuelve el número de línea física donde se encuentra el carácter indizado en el control.The GetLineFromCharIndex method returns the physical line number where the indexed character is located within the control. Por ejemplo, si una parte de la primera línea lógica de texto en el control se ajusta a la línea siguiente, el GetLineFromCharIndex método devuelve 1 si el carácter que se encuentra en el índice de caracteres especificado se ajusta a la segunda línea física.For example, if a portion of the first logical line of text in the control wraps to the next line, the GetLineFromCharIndex method returns 1 if the character at the specified character index has wrapped to the second physical line. Si WordWrap se establece en false, ninguna parte de la línea se ajusta a la siguiente y el método devuelve 0 para el índice de carácter especificado.If WordWrap is set to false, no portion of the line wraps to the next, and the method returns 0 for the specified character index. Puede usar este método para determinar en qué línea se encuentra un índice de carácter específico.You can use this method to determine which line a specific character index is located within. Por ejemplo, después de llamar Find al método para buscar texto, puede obtener el índice de carácter en el que se encuentran los resultados de la búsqueda.For example, after calling the Find method to search for text, you can obtain the character index to where the search results are found. Puede llamar a este método con el índice de carácter devuelto Find por el método para determinar qué línea se encontró la palabra.You can call this method with the character index returned by the Find method to determine which line the word was found.

Nota

Si el índice de caracteres especificado en index el parámetro está por encima del número de líneas disponible en el control, se devuelve el último número de línea.If the character index specified in the index parameter is beyond the available number of lines contained within the control, the last line number is returned.

Se aplica a

Consulte también: